    A Brief Life Illuminated: Devin Leonardi and the Pursuit of Contemporary Realism

    Devin Leonardi, a name resonating within contemporary realist circles, experienced a tragically short but intensely focused artistic career. Born in Evanston, Illinois, in 1981, his life was cut short in Helena, Montana, in 2014 at the age of thirty-three. Despite this brevity, Leonardi left behind a compelling body of work characterized by evocative landscapes and figures, paintings that speak to a profound connection with nature and an insightful understanding of human experience. His story isn’t one of decades spent honing technique; it's a concentrated burst of talent driven by a clear vision, making his all-too-few pieces particularly poignant. Leonardi wasn’t simply replicating what he saw; he was translating feeling – the weight of atmosphere, the quietude of solitude, the subtle complexities of emotion – onto canvas with remarkable skill.

    Early Development and Artistic Influences

    While details surrounding Leonardi's formal art education remain somewhat sparse, it’s clear his artistic journey wasn’t rooted in traditional academic training. He largely developed his distinctive style through self-directed study and immersion in the natural world. The landscapes of Montana, where he eventually settled, became a primary source of inspiration. He absorbed influences from the 19th-century Hudson River School painters – artists like Albert Bierstadt and Frederic Church – whose grand depictions of American scenery resonated with his own desire to capture the sublime power of nature. However, Leonardi wasn’t merely imitating these masters; he infused their romantic sensibility with a distinctly contemporary edge. He also demonstrated an affinity for the work of Edward Hopper, particularly in his ability to convey a sense of isolation and introspection within seemingly ordinary scenes. This blend of historical reverence and modern psychological awareness became a hallmark of his style.

    Themes and Techniques: Capturing Light and Emotion

    Leonardi’s paintings are immediately recognizable for their masterful handling of light and shadow. He possessed an exceptional ability to render the nuances of atmospheric perspective, creating a sense of depth and realism that draws the viewer into the scene. His palette, while often muted, was rich with subtle variations in tone, allowing him to capture the ephemeral qualities of light – the golden glow of sunset, the cool grayness of a winter morning, the dappled sunlight filtering through trees. Beyond technical prowess, Leonardi’s work is deeply imbued with emotional resonance. His landscapes aren't simply pretty pictures; they evoke feelings of solitude, contemplation, and a sense of connection to something larger than oneself. Similarly, his figure paintings – often depicting solitary individuals – explore themes of vulnerability, introspection, and the search for meaning in a complex world. He frequently employed glazing techniques, building up layers of thin paint to create luminous effects and subtle gradations of color. This meticulous approach allowed him to achieve a remarkable level of detail and realism, while also imbuing his paintings with a sense of depth and atmosphere.
